Last fall, Operation Warm launched its new College and University Program at The University of Pennsylvania in Philadelphia.
June 5, 2009
Members of Penn’s Panhellenic and MultiCultural Greek sororities raised funds by having bake sales, soliciting friends, parents and fellow students, bringing in over $4,500. That allowed the group to provide new coats to over 300 students at the nearby Alexander Wilson School, a public elementary school about a half mile from the campus. VIEW MORE
